Close ✕Burgess Shale, Yoho National Park
A Middle Cambrian deposit of about 508 million years old on Fossil Ridge between Wapta Mountain and Mount Field in Yoho National Park, British Columbia, and the most consequential fossil…
51.4, -116.5 · approximate · fossils c. 508 Ma; quarried from 1909

Connections
- instance of Konservat-Lagerstätte (exceptional preservation) — Burgess animals are preserved as flattened carbon films retaining gills, guts, eyes and limbs, which requires rapid burial and anoxic conditions.
